Colorado
Vincentian Volunteers
We
are a community of faith and action that responds to the Gospel
call in the spirit of St. Vincent de Paul. We are young men
and women, ages 22-30, who serve Denver's poor, elderly, homeless,
developmentally disabled and troubled youth. Our year-long program
offers an opportunity for spiritual, emotional, professional
growth, and a way of discerning and living one's Christian vocation.
